What is a Registered Agent?
A designated representative is an individual or business entity appointed to accept legal documents and government notices on behalf of a company or limited liability company. This function is crucial as the registered agent makes sure that important communications, such as legal actions or official correspondence from the state, are delivered promptly to the business. The registered agent serves as a contact point for government agencies and is responsible for maintaining compliance with regulatory requirements.
In many states, including Washington, having a registered agent is a legal requirement for companies operating within the state, as well as for out-of-state companies looking to operate in that state. The registered agent must have a physical address in the state where the company is incorporated or registered and must be available during regular business hours to accept documents. This requirement helps provide a dependable method for government officials and others to reach the company.

Expenses and Prices of WA Registered Representatives
When picking a designated agent in Washington, it's crucial to understand the related fees and prices. Usually, designated agent services in WA vary from approximately 100 to $300 per year. This variance is affected by the service provider's standing, the quality of customer support, and additional services offered, such as forwarding mail and compliance support. Compliance Requirements for Registered Agents in Washington
In the State of Washington, designated representatives play a vital role in maintaining the lawful and operational compliance of businesses. Each corporation and LLC must designate a designated representative who is available during business hours to receive official papers, notifications, and other critical communication from the government and third parties. The registered agent can be an person or a corporate entity licensed to do operations in Washington, and they must have a tangible location in the region.
To meet their responsibilities, registered agents in Washington must confirm that they remain updated about any modifications in state laws and rules that may impact their clients. This comprises being aware of the requirements for filing yearly filings, keeping track of deadlines, and confirming that all required documentation is filed on time. Failure to comply with these requirements can result in fines, delays, or even the dissolution of the company.
